About the awards

How are Consensus Award winners chosen?

Each award has a documented methodology — usually the highest weighted Market Consensus in a supporting category, or the largest positive Consensus delta since our last snapshot. Winners aren't a single editor's pick; they fall out of the dataset.

Why are some winners not #1 on every source?

Consensus rewards durability across sources, not winning a single list. A tool that consistently lands in the top 3 across most of our 9 independent sources can beat a tool that's #1 on two surfaces and unranked everywhere else.

What sources back the awards?

FutureFounder, G2, Capterra, Product Hunt, Futurepedia, Tool Finder, AI Tools Directory, and Reddit Community Sentiment. Coverage varies by category — each winner card links to the supporting consensus category for full source breakdown.

How often are the awards updated?

Annually. Mid-year movement is captured in the Consensus Insights (Most Improved, Trending, Biggest Movers) so the awards page itself stays a stable yearly artifact.
